Brief Summary
Long term results after pulmonary vein isolation (PVI) with robotic navigation in patients with drug refractory atrial fibrillation are not inferior to manual radiofrequency current ablation.

Eligibility Criteria
You may qualify if:
- paroxysmal atrial fibrillation
- persistent atrial fibrillation \< 2 month
- indication for catheter ablation
- LEF \> 50%
- diameter LA \< 50 mm
You may not qualify if:
- intracardial thrombus
- atrial fibrillation with underlying curable disease
- renal failure \> stage I
- contraindication for anticoagulation
- life expectancy \< 12 month
- previous PVI
- pregnancy
